About the Role

The Senior Technical Business Analyst plays a pivotal role in bridging the gap between business needs and technical solutions. This position focuses on analyzing business requirements and designing strategic solutions while collaborating cross-functionally. The analyst will take a lead role in the early stages of the project lifecycle, ensuring that solutions align seamlessly with business objectives and IT architectural standards. The role is to not only lead analysis on critical projects but also to help establish the business analysis framework and best practices within the organization.


What You'll Do

  • Business Needs Analysis: Conduct comprehensive analyses to understand and document complex business challenges, objectives, and opportunities.
  • Solution Design & Validation: Develop innovative and effective solutions to address identified gaps and meet business needs. Collaborate with IT and business leaders to validate that proposed solutions meet business needs and technical requirements.
  • Requirements Gathering: Elicit, document, and prioritize business and technical requirements from stakeholders across departments. Translate these into actionable artifacts, including user stories, traceability matrices, acceptance criteria and functional specifications.
  • Process Modeling: Create detailed process maps and workflows to visualize current and future-state processes.
  • Gap Analysis: Perform in-depth evaluations of current systems and processes to identify discrepancies, risks and areas for improvement.
  • Stakeholder Engagement: Facilitate discussions with stakeholders to gather requirements, build consensus and validate proposed solutions.
  • Establish Best Practices: As a key member of PMO, contribute to the development and implementation of BA standards, templates, and methodologies (Agile, Hybrid).

Key Goals

  • Early Project Lifecycle Focus: Take ownership of the analysis and design stages to shape project direction effectively.
  • Outcome Alignment: Ensure solutions align with business objectives and complement the strategies of IT architects.


What We're Looking For

  • Proven experience as a Technical Business Analyst, ideally in a senior or lead capacity.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Information Systems, Computer Science, or a related field.
  • Extensive experience working cross-functionally within diverse organizational structures.
  • Familiarity with tools and methodologies such as BPMN, UML, Agile/Scrum frameworks, and enterprise-level software solutions.
  • Experience with data analysis, including writing basic SQL queries for data validation and mapping. Familiarity with API concepts (REST) is highly desirable.
  • CBAP, PMI-PBA, or similar certifications are a strong plus.

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
